当前位置: 首页 > article >正文

OpenArm开源机械臂终极指南:从零开始构建你的7自由度人形手臂

OpenArm开源机械臂终极指南从零开始构建你的7自由度人形手臂【免费下载链接】openarmA fully open-source humanoid arm for physical AI research and deployment in contact-rich environments.项目地址: https://gitcode.com/GitHub_Trending/op/openarmOpenArm是一个完全开源的人形机械臂项目专为物理AI研究和接触丰富的环境部署而设计。这个项目提供了完整的硬件设计、软件控制、仿真工具和文档让你能够以仅6500美元的成本构建一个7自由度的双臂系统。无论你是机器人爱好者、研究人员还是教育工作者OpenArm都为你提供了一个强大而经济实惠的平台用于实现先进的机器人应用和研究。 入门指南快速搭建你的第一个机械臂硬件准备与采购清单开始之前你需要准备OpenArm的所有组件。好消息是所有零部件都是标准化和可购买的不需要特殊定制件。项目提供了完整的物料清单BOM包含每个部件的详细采购信息。核心组件包括机械结构件铝制框架、不锈钢连接件电机系统7个QDD准直接驱动电机提供高背驱动力和安全性控制系统CAN-FD通信板、电源模块末端执行器可定制的夹爪系统电气连接所有必要的线缆和连接器分步组装教程组装过程被分解为多个逻辑模块每个关节都有详细的组装指南。让我们看看J1-J2关节的组装示例基础组装步骤底座安装从基座开始确保所有固定点牢固关节连接按照顺序连接各个关节注意对齐标记电机安装小心安装每个QDD电机确保接线正确电气连接按照接线图连接所有电缆最终调试完成机械组装后进行初步测试每个步骤都有详细的图片说明和注意事项即使是初学者也能轻松跟随。电气系统配置电气系统是机械臂的大脑和神经系统。OpenArm使用CAN-FD总线进行高速通信确保1kHz的控制频率。电气配置要点电源管理24V直流供电确保足够的功率CAN总线菊花链连接所有电机和传感器安全系统紧急停止按钮和限位开关通信接口USB到CAN-FD转换器 进阶应用软件控制与仿真环境ROS2集成与控制OpenArm完全支持ROS2机器人操作系统2提供了丰富的软件包和节点。通过ROS2你可以轻松实现运动规划、传感器集成和高级控制算法。ROS2核心功能运动规划使用MoveIt2进行路径规划和避障传感器融合集成视觉、力觉等多传感器数据实时控制1kHz控制频率确保精确运动仿真接口无缝连接Gazebo和MuJoCo仿真环境仿真环境搭建在真实硬件上测试之前你可以在仿真环境中验证算法和控制系统。支持的仿真平台仿真平台主要特点适用场景MuJoCo高精度物理仿真控制算法开发Isaac LabNVIDIA GPU加速大规模强化学习GazeboROS原生支持系统集成测试夹爪系统定制OpenArm的末端执行器是完全可定制的你可以根据具体任务需求设计不同的夹爪。夹爪定制选项平行夹爪适合抓取规则物体三指灵巧手适合复杂操作任务工具快换系统支持多种末端工具力传感器集成实现精确的力控制⚙️ 高级配置安全性与性能优化安全第一的设计理念OpenArm在设计时就考虑了安全性特别是在人机交互场景中。安全特性机械限位每个关节都有物理限位防止超范围运动软件限位在控制层添加额外的运动限制紧急停止硬件和软件双重紧急停止系统力反馈实时监测关节力矩防止过载性能调优技巧要让机械臂发挥最佳性能需要进行适当的调优。性能优化建议PID参数调整根据负载特性调整每个电机的PID参数通信优化确保CAN总线通信稳定避免数据丢失机械校准定期进行零位校准和关节对齐热管理监控电机温度防止过热OpenArm Cell工作单元对于需要标准化实验环境的研究OpenArm Cell提供了完整的解决方案。Cell系统特点标准化安装统一的相机、照明和机械臂位置安全防护内置的安全停止和防护框架扩展能力Z轴扩展支持更多任务类型即插即用使用现货组件易于维护和升级 最佳实践从研究到部署数据收集与模仿学习OpenArm特别适合接触丰富的任务数据收集这是物理AI研究的关键。数据收集流程任务设计定义具体的操作任务和评价指标示教录制通过遥操作收集专家演示数据数据处理清理和标注收集到的轨迹数据模型训练使用收集的数据训练控制策略评估验证在仿真和真实环境中验证模型性能遥操作与双边控制OpenArm支持高精度的遥操作包括双边力反馈控制。遥操作模式对比控制模式反馈类型适用场景单边控制位置控制简单远程操作双边控制位置力反馈精细操作任务VR控制沉浸式体验复杂空间任务社区贡献与协作OpenArm是一个真正的开源项目欢迎社区成员的贡献。如何参与代码贡献提交PR改进软件功能文档改进帮助完善教程和文档硬件设计分享改进的机械设计应用案例分享你的成功应用经验故障排除常见问题Q机械臂无法启动怎么办A检查电源连接、CAN总线连接和电机ID配置Q运动不流畅或有抖动A调整PID参数检查机械装配是否牢固Q如何更新固件A使用提供的固件更新工具按照教程步骤操作Q仿真环境无法连接真实硬件A检查网络配置和ROS2节点通信 扩展资源与学习路径官方文档资源硬件文档website/docs/hardware/软件指南website/docs/software/组装教程website/docs/hardware/assembly-guide/仿真教程website/docs/simulation/推荐学习路径初学者从硬件组装开始了解机械结构中级用户学习ROS2基础和控制编程高级用户探索高级控制算法和AI集成研究人员利用平台进行物理AI研究项目生态与未来OpenArm不仅仅是一个机械臂项目它是一个完整的生态系统硬件开源所有CAD文件和BOM完全公开软件开源控制代码、仿真环境全部开源社区驱动由全球开发者和研究者共同维护持续发展定期更新和改进跟上技术发展 开始你的机器人之旅OpenArm为你提供了一个独特的机会让你能够以相对较低的成本接触到最先进的机器人技术。无论你是想学习机器人技术、进行学术研究还是开发商业应用OpenArm都是一个理想的起点。立即行动克隆仓库git clone https://gitcode.com/GitHub_Trending/op/openarm查看文档仔细阅读项目文档准备材料根据BOM采购所需组件开始组装按照教程一步步构建加入社区在Discord上与其他人交流记住机器人技术的学习是一个渐进的过程。从简单的任务开始逐步挑战更复杂的应用。OpenArm社区随时准备帮助你解决问题分享经验。你的机器人梦想从OpenArm开始✨【免费下载链接】openarmA fully open-source humanoid arm for physical AI research and deployment in contact-rich environments.项目地址: https://gitcode.com/GitHub_Trending/op/openarm创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

相关文章:

OpenArm开源机械臂终极指南:从零开始构建你的7自由度人形手臂

OpenArm开源机械臂终极指南:从零开始构建你的7自由度人形手臂 【免费下载链接】openarm A fully open-source humanoid arm for physical AI research and deployment in contact-rich environments. 项目地址: https://gitcode.com/GitHub_Trending/op/openarm …...

Cursor设备标识重置技术:3分钟解决试用限制的完整方案

Cursor设备标识重置技术:3分钟解决试用限制的完整方案 【免费下载链接】go-cursor-help 解决Cursor在免费订阅期间出现以下提示的问题: Your request has been blocked as our system has detected suspicious activity / Youve reached your trial request limit. …...

Cat-Catch终极指南:5步快速掌握网页资源抓取技巧

Cat-Catch终极指南:5步快速掌握网页资源抓取技巧 【免费下载链接】cat-catch 猫抓 浏览器资源嗅探扩展 / cat-catch Browser Resource Sniffing Extension 项目地址: https://gitcode.com/GitHub_Trending/ca/cat-catch 你是否曾在网上看到一个精彩的视频教程…...

麒麟系统上跑32位老程序,别再折腾了!用这个离线打包法,5分钟搞定依赖

麒麟系统32位程序兼容方案:离线依赖打包全流程指南 在国产化操作系统迁移浪潮中,许多企业面临一个共同难题——那些关键业务依赖的32位遗留程序如何在仅支持64位的新系统上运行?本文将以麒麟系统为例,详解一套经过实战检验的离线依…...

CANN/asc-devkit DropOut高阶API

DropOut 【免费下载链接】asc-devkit 本项目是CANN 推出的昇腾AI处理器专用的算子程序开发语言,原生支持C和C标准规范,主要由类库和语言扩展层构成,提供多层级API,满足多维场景算子开发诉求。 项目地址: https://gitcode.com/ca…...

网络工程师避坑指南:eNSP中配置Eth-Trunk链路聚合的5个常见错误与排查方法

网络工程师避坑指南:eNSP中配置Eth-Trunk链路聚合的5个常见错误与排查方法 在华为eNSP模拟器中配置Eth-Trunk链路聚合时,许多网络工程师都会遇到各种"翻车"现场。明明按照教程一步步操作,却发现带宽没有叠加、端口状态异常&#xf…...

从面积与性能权衡出发:深度解析Tessent MBIST中Bypass/Observation逻辑的配置艺术

从面积与性能权衡出发:深度解析Tessent MBIST中Bypass/Observation逻辑的配置艺术 在芯片设计领域,测试逻辑的插入往往被视为一把双刃剑。一方面,它确保了芯片的可测试性和可靠性;另一方面,这些额外逻辑又不可避免地带…...

AndroidCupsPrint:解锁手机无线打印的终极密钥,告别数据线束缚!

AndroidCupsPrint:解锁手机无线打印的终极密钥,告别数据线束缚! 【免费下载链接】AndroidCupsPrint Port of cups4j to Android. Allows wireless printing from any Android device to any CUPS-enabled print server or network printer. …...

如何彻底解决IDM激活问题:开源脚本终极指南

如何彻底解决IDM激活问题:开源脚本终极指南 【免费下载链接】IDM-Activation-Script IDM Activation & Trail Reset Script 项目地址: https://gitcode.com/gh_mirrors/id/IDM-Activation-Script Internet Download Manager激活弹窗困扰着无数用户&#…...

RimSort:三分钟告别RimWorld模组管理噩梦的终极方案

RimSort:三分钟告别RimWorld模组管理噩梦的终极方案 【免费下载链接】RimSort RimSort is an open source mod manager for the video game RimWorld. There is support for Linux, Mac, and Windows, built from the ground up to be a reliable, community-manage…...

CANN/asc-devkit SoftMax接口

SoftMax 【免费下载链接】asc-devkit 本项目是CANN 推出的昇腾AI处理器专用的算子程序开发语言,原生支持C和C标准规范,主要由类库和语言扩展层构成,提供多层级API,满足多维场景算子开发诉求。 项目地址: https://gitcode.com/ca…...

机器人学习快速入门指南:掌握Open X-Embodiment开源数据集

机器人学习快速入门指南:掌握Open X-Embodiment开源数据集 【免费下载链接】open_x_embodiment 项目地址: https://gitcode.com/gh_mirrors/op/open_x_embodiment 想要快速入门机器人学习领域?Open X-Embodiment为你提供了一个完整的机器人学习开…...

实战SAR船舶检测:SSDD数据集完整应用指南

实战SAR船舶检测:SSDD数据集完整应用指南 【免费下载链接】Official-SSDD SAR Ship Detection Dataset (SSDD): Official Release and Comprehensive Data Analysis 项目地址: https://gitcode.com/gh_mirrors/of/Official-SSDD 海洋监控与船舶检测一直是遥感…...

CANN Ascend C矩阵乘法特殊配置

GetSpecialMDLConfig 【免费下载链接】asc-devkit 本项目是CANN 推出的昇腾AI处理器专用的算子程序开发语言,原生支持C和C标准规范,主要由类库和语言扩展层构成,提供多层级API,满足多维场景算子开发诉求。 项目地址: https://gi…...

5大技术突破:Unity Figma Bridge如何革命性改变游戏UI开发流程

5大技术突破:Unity Figma Bridge如何革命性改变游戏UI开发流程 【免费下载链接】UnityFigmaBridge Easily bring your Figma Documents, Components, Assets and Prototypes to Unity 项目地址: https://gitcode.com/gh_mirrors/un/UnityFigmaBridge Unity F…...

解密ASCII图表魔法:ditaa将文本艺术转化为专业图表的技术揭秘

解密ASCII图表魔法:ditaa将文本艺术转化为专业图表的技术揭秘 【免费下载链接】ditaa ditaa is a small command-line utility that can convert diagrams drawn using ascii art (drawings that contain characters that resemble lines like | / - ), into proper…...

Input Leap终极指南:3步实现跨设备键盘鼠标无缝共享

Input Leap终极指南:3步实现跨设备键盘鼠标无缝共享 【免费下载链接】input-leap Open-source KVM software 项目地址: https://gitcode.com/gh_mirrors/in/input-leap 你是否厌倦了在多台电脑之间频繁切换键盘和鼠标?Input Leap跨设备控制功能正…...

3步掌握Vidupe:基于内容识别的智能视频去重终极指南

3步掌握Vidupe:基于内容识别的智能视频去重终极指南 【免费下载链接】vidupe Vidupe is a program that can find duplicate and similar video files. V1.211 released on 2019-09-18, Windows exe here: 项目地址: https://gitcode.com/gh_mirrors/vi/vidupe …...

3步快速部署海风小店微信小程序商城 - 开源免费商用实战指南

3步快速部署海风小店微信小程序商城 - 开源免费商用实战指南 【免费下载链接】hioshop-miniprogram 微信小程序商城,开源免费商用,海风小店 项目地址: https://gitcode.com/gh_mirrors/hi/hioshop-miniprogram 海风小店是一款基于Node.jsThinkJSM…...

Midjourney年度订阅最后上车机会:官方邮件暗藏“早鸟密钥”,输入即解锁终身$129→$79(已验证有效期至2024-12-15)

更多请点击: https://kaifayun.com 第一章:Midjourney年度订阅优惠的官方政策与背景解析 Midjourney自2023年起正式将年度订阅(Annual Plan)纳入其核心付费体系,旨在为长期用户降低平均月成本并强化服务稳定性。该政策…...

3个关键决策:为什么顶级技术团队选择Arco Design Pro构建企业级应用

3个关键决策:为什么顶级技术团队选择Arco Design Pro构建企业级应用 【免费下载链接】arco-design-pro An out-of-the-box solution to quickly build enterprise-level applications based on Arco Design. 项目地址: https://gitcode.com/gh_mirrors/ar/arco-de…...

React Google Maps自定义地图控件开发:扩展原生控件的完整指南

React Google Maps自定义地图控件开发:扩展原生控件的完整指南 【免费下载链接】react-google-maps React components and hooks for the Google Maps JavaScript API 项目地址: https://gitcode.com/gh_mirrors/rea/react-google-maps 你是否想让你的Google…...

凡亿AD22--PCB全连接与十字花焊盘连接铺铜规则

核心重点:铺铜与焊盘/过孔的连接方式,核心分为「全连接」「十字连接」「不连接」三种,实际设计中仅常用前两种;连接方式的选择,核心取决于「焊接方式」「载流需求」,过孔连接需默认采用全连接,避…...

语音钓鱼中转窝点运作机理与全链条防控研究 —— 基于韩国仁川警方案例

摘要 2026 年 5 月 19 日韩国仁川西部警方通报,破获一起以高薪兼职为诱饵招募人员、在住宿场所运营语音钓鱼中转窝点的案件,抓获两名管理人员,查获一次性手机 105 部、冒用他人身份 SIM 卡 356 张、无线路由器 4 台,涉案人员通过远…...

MATLAB文件选择对话框uigetfile()保姆级教程:从单文件到多选的完整配置流程

MATLAB文件选择对话框uigetfile()实战指南:从基础配置到高级技巧 在MATLAB日常开发中,文件选择对话框是用户交互的重要组成部分。uigetfile()函数作为MATLAB内置的文件选择工具,其灵活性和可定制性往往被初学者低估。本文将带您深入探索这个看…...

Sora 2时间轴与Blender NLA编辑器深度对齐指南(2024.06.12 Blender官方补丁前最后兼容方案)

更多请点击: https://intelliparadigm.com 第一章:Sora 2与Blender整合的底层架构演进 Sora 2并非独立运行的视频生成引擎,而是以模块化推理服务(Modular Inference Service, MIS)为核心构建的分布式计算框架。其与Bl…...

FreeRTOS互斥锁的‘坑’与‘宝’:优先级翻转那些事儿,用ESP32实测给你看

FreeRTOS互斥锁的‘坑’与‘宝’:优先级翻转那些事儿,用ESP32实测给你看 在嵌入式实时系统中,任务调度和资源管理是核心挑战。当你开始设计多任务系统时,很快会遇到一个经典问题:多个任务需要访问共享资源(…...

Bifrost:跨平台三星固件下载神器,解锁设备管理的全新境界

Bifrost:跨平台三星固件下载神器,解锁设备管理的全新境界 【免费下载链接】Bifrost Cross-platform tool for downloading Samsung mobile device firmware. 项目地址: https://gitcode.com/gh_mirrors/sa/Bifrost 你是否曾为寻找三星官方固件而烦…...

Android Studio中文界面终极解决方案:告别官方插件的兼容性烦恼

Android Studio中文界面终极解决方案:告别官方插件的兼容性烦恼 【免费下载链接】AndroidStudioChineseLanguagePack AndroidStudio中文插件(官方修改版本) 项目地址: https://gitcode.com/gh_mirrors/an/AndroidStudioChineseLanguagePack 还在为…...

用Python实现迷宫寻路:从BFS到‘灌水算法’的保姆级代码解析

Python迷宫寻路算法实战:从BFS到动态赋值的完整实现指南 迷宫寻路问题是计算机科学中经典的算法应用场景,也是游戏开发、机器人导航等领域的核心技术之一。本文将带领你从最基础的广度优先搜索(BFS)算法开始,逐步深入到…...